Former Real Sociedad midfielder David Silva is happy doing his knee recovery in San Sebastian.

Silva announced his retirement after breaking down in preseason.

He told El Diario Vasco: "The signing was done very quickly. The truth is that I was right to come, because I am loving it in San Sebastin, as well as the three years I was with the team.

"My family is delighted here, the people have always shown us a lot of love, and that is why we decided to do the knee recovery here and stay in San Sebastin. We had everything planned to continue playing for another year and the children's schools were booked."

On his recovery, he added: "It's going very well, really. Right now it is my priority and I don't think about anything else."
